Welcome to Moosehead Family Campground, your ideal destination for a relaxing and enjoyable camping experience in Greenville, Maine. Nestled near the picturesque Moosehead Lake, our campground offers a variety of site options to suit your needs, from private spots to more open areas. Whether you're here for a weekend getaway or an extended stay, we provide a welcoming environment for families, couples, and solo adventurers alike.
Our campground features clean and well-stocked bathroom facilities, hot showers, and firewood available for purchase on-site. The owners live on the premises and are dedicated to maintaining and improving the campground to ensure a pleasant stay for all guests.
